Description

【0001】
【産業上の利用分野】
本発明は木材の研摩粉を含有した制振材に関し、詳細には、自動車用制振材、建築、構築物用、家電製品用として使用される制振材のシート状態での柔軟性の向上とともに補強効果により、特には高温での制振性能をも向上せしめた木材の研摩粉を含有した制振材に関する。
【0002】
【従来の技術】
従来より、自動車の車室内・外、建築・構築物、家電製品等の40℃以上における温度でのより一層の騒音の低減化、静寂化の要請から更に優れた制振性能を有する制振材の開発が待ち望まれているのが現状であり、特にリサイクル品を活用して、環境上、経済上の点からも優れた制振材が望まれている。
【0003】
【発明が解決しようとする課題】
40℃以上の温度に上昇する部位において、所望の制振効果を顕現しつつ、被装着物の凹凸形状へのなじみ性に優れ、一層の制振効果に寄与する制振材を提案するものである。
【0004】
【課題を解決するための手段】
かかる課題を解決せんとして、本発明者らは鋭意研究の結果、充填材として、木材の研摩粉を特定量含有した制振材となすことにより、40℃以上に上昇する部位において優れた制振効果を発揮し得ることを見出すに至ったものであり、しかして本発明の要旨は、以下に存する。
【0005】
アスファルト20〜40重量%、炭酸カルシウム50〜70重量%を含んでなる歴青系のシート状制振材において、その充填材成分として繊維径が100μm以下の木材の研磨粉を3〜25重量%配合し、その他必要に応じて添加剤を全量の10重量%以下配合してなることを特徴とする木材の研磨粉を含有したシート状制振材。
【0006】
本発明の必須の構成要件である、充填材として配合する木材の研磨粉は、例えば、家具等の製造時に生じる研磨粉が適当な量の樹脂を含み好ましい。研磨粉であるから、繊維径は、100μm以下が好ましく、50μm程度が中心になるようにする。かかる木粉は全量の3〜25重量%配合することを必須とする。3重量%未満の配合では、所望の効果が期待し得ず、25重量%を超える配合ではシート化できないという不具合がある。
【0007】
また、他の充填材成分としては、炭酸カルシウムを50〜70重量%配合することを必須とするほか、タルク、硫酸バリウム等の充填材の混入が可能である。古新聞等を開繊した故紙粉砕物は、本発明の特徴である木材の研摩粉によって代替される。
【0008】
本発明になる制振材のバインダー成分としては、ストレートアスファルト及び/又はブロンアスファルト等のアスファルトを20〜50重量%配合することを必須とし、その他合成樹脂、合成ゴム等からなる加熱により溶融するバインダー成分を必要に応じて配合する。また、その他必要に応じて増粘剤、消泡剤や造膜助剤等の添加剤を全量の10重量%以下配合できる。
【0009】
本発明になる制振材を製造するには、上記の各種配合物をディゾルバー、バンバリーミキサー、プラネタリーミキサー、オープンニーダー、真空ニーダー等の従来公知の混合分散機によって分散混練して後、カレンダーロール等の圧延機により所望の厚さのシート状制振材となす。得られたシートを被制振面の形状に合わせてトリムする。必要に応じて裏面に感圧性接着剤を塗布して、離型紙を貼れば、傾斜面、垂直面にも適用できる。
【0010】
【実施例】
本発明の理解に供するため、以下に実施例を記載する。いうまでもなく、本発明は以下の実施例に限定されるものではない。
【0011】
【実施例1】
アスファルト(ブローンアスファルト:ストレートアスファルト=1:1、昭和シェル石油(株)製)30重量%、炭酸カルシウム65重量%、木材の研摩粉3重量%及びマイカ2重量%からなる混合物を混練し、2mmに圧延加工して3kgの制振材となした。
【0012】
【実施例2】アスファルト(ブローンアスファルト:ストレートアスファルト=1:1、昭和シェル石油(株)製)23重量%、炭酸カルシウム50重量%、木材の研磨粉25重量%及びマイカ2重量%からなる混合物を混練し、2mmに圧延加工して3kgの制振材となした。
【0013】
【実施例3】
アスファルト(ブローンアスファルト:ストレートアスファルト=1:1、昭和シェル石油(株)製)27重量%、炭酸カルシウム55重量%、木材の研摩粉15重量%及びマイカ3重量%からなる混合物を混練し、2mmに圧延加工して3kgの制振材となした。
【0014】
【比較例1】
アスファルト(ブローンアスファルト:ストレートアスファルト=1:1、昭和シェル石油(株)製)25重量%、炭酸カルシウム70重量%、木材の研摩粉2重量%及びマイカ3重量%からなる混合物を混練し、2mmに圧延加工して3kgの制振材となした。
【0015】
【比較例2】
アスファルト(ブローンアスファルト:ストレートアスファルト=1:1、昭和シェル石油(株)製)30重量%、炭酸カルシウム44重量%及び木材の研摩粉26重量%からなる混合物を混練し、2mmに圧延加工して3kgの制振材となした。
【0016】
【試験方法1】
実施例及び比較例になる制振材のプレス打ち抜き性(加熱加圧成形時のトリム性)、落ち込み性(凹凸状鋼板面への密着性)を試験した。
【0017】
【試験方法2】
共振法(日本音響材料協会出版「騒音対策ハンドブック」438頁参照)により20℃、40℃、60℃の各温度における損失係数ηを測定した。ηは値が大きいほど制振効果が高く、0.05以上であれば制振効果があるとされている。
【0018】
【結果1】

[Industrial applications]
The present invention relates to a vibration damping material containing abrasive powder of wood, and more particularly, to a vibration damping material used for automobiles, buildings, structures, and home electric appliances, with an improvement in flexibility in a sheet state. The present invention relates to a vibration damping material containing an abrasive powder of wood, which has improved the vibration damping performance particularly at high temperatures due to a reinforcing effect.
[0002]
[Prior art]
Conventionally, vibration reduction materials with even better vibration damping performance have been demanded in order to further reduce noise and reduce noise at temperatures above 40 ° C, such as inside and outside automobiles, buildings and structures, and home appliances. At present, development is awaited. In particular, there is a need for a vibration damping material that is excellent in environmental and economical aspects by utilizing recycled products.
[0003]
[Problems to be solved by the invention]
It proposes a vibration-damping material that exhibits a desired vibration-damping effect in a region where the temperature rises to 40 ° C. or higher, has excellent adaptability to the uneven shape of the mounted object, and contributes to a further vibration-damping effect. is there.
[0004]
[Means for Solving the Problems]
In order to solve such a problem, the present inventors have conducted intensive studies and found that, as a filler, a vibration damping material containing a specific amount of wood abrasive powder is used, so that excellent vibration damping can be achieved at a temperature of 40 ° C. or higher. It has been found that an effect can be exerted, and the gist of the present invention resides in the following.
[0005]
In a bituminous sheet-like vibration damping material containing 20 to 40% by weight of asphalt and 50 to 70% by weight of calcium carbonate, 3 to 25% by weight of wood polishing powder having a fiber diameter of 100 μm or less as a filler component. A sheet-like vibration damping material containing wood polishing powder, which is blended, and if necessary, an additive is blended in an amount of 10% by weight or less based on the total amount.
[0006]
The wood polishing powder to be blended as a filler, which is an essential component of the present invention, is preferably, for example, a polishing powder generated at the time of manufacturing furniture or the like containing an appropriate amount of resin. Since it is an abrasive powder, the fiber diameter is preferably 100 μm or less, and the center is about 50 μm . It is essential that such wood flour be blended in an amount of 3 to 25% by weight of the total amount. If the amount is less than 3% by weight, the desired effect cannot be expected. If the amount exceeds 25% by weight, a sheet cannot be formed.
[0007]
As other filler components, it is essential that calcium carbonate is blended in an amount of 50 to 70% by weight, and fillers such as talc and barium sulfate can be mixed. The waste paper pulverized material obtained by opening old newspapers or the like is replaced by wood abrasive powder which is a feature of the present invention.
[0008]
As a binder component of the vibration damping material according to the present invention, it is essential that asphalt such as straight asphalt and / or bron asphalt be blended in an amount of 20 to 50% by weight, and a binder made of synthetic resin, synthetic rubber, or the like, which is melted by heating. Ingredients are blended as needed. Further, if necessary, additives such as a thickener, an antifoaming agent and a film-forming aid can be blended in an amount of 10% by weight or less based on the whole amount.
[0009]
In order to produce the vibration damping material according to the present invention, the above-mentioned various components are dispersed and kneaded by a conventionally known mixing and dispersing machine such as a dissolver, a Banbury mixer, a planetary mixer, an open kneader, and a vacuum kneader, and then a calender roll. To form a sheet-like vibration damping material having a desired thickness. The obtained sheet is trimmed according to the shape of the surface to be damped. If necessary, a pressure-sensitive adhesive may be applied to the back surface, and a release paper may be applied to the back surface, so that it can be applied to inclined surfaces and vertical surfaces.
[0010]
【Example】
Examples will be described below to facilitate understanding of the present invention. Needless to say, the present invention is not limited to the following examples.
[0011]
Embodiment 1
Asphalt (blown asphalt: straight asphalt = 1: 1, manufactured by Showa Shell Sekiyu KK) 30% by weight, 65% by weight of calcium carbonate, a mixture of 3% by weight of wood polishing powder and 2% by weight of mica are kneaded, and 2 mm is mixed. Into a 3 kg damping material.
[0012]
Example 2 Asphalt (blown asphalt: straight asphalt = 1: 1, manufactured by Showa Shell Sekiyu KK) 23 % by weight, 50 % by weight of calcium carbonate, 25% by weight of wood polishing powder and 2% by weight of mica Was kneaded and rolled to 2 mm to form a 3 kg damping material.
[0013]
Embodiment 3
Asphalt (blown asphalt: straight asphalt = 1: 1, manufactured by Showa Shell Sekiyu KK) 27% by weight, 55% by weight of calcium carbonate, a mixture of 15% by weight of wood polishing powder and 3% by weight of mica are kneaded, and 2 mm is mixed. Into a 3 kg damping material.
[0014]
[Comparative Example 1]
Asphalt (blown asphalt: straight asphalt = 1: 1, manufactured by Showa Shell Sekiyu KK) 25% by weight, 70% by weight of calcium carbonate, 2% by weight of wood abrasive powder and 3% by weight of mica are kneaded, and 2 mm is kneaded. Into a 3 kg damping material.
[0015]
[Comparative Example 2]
Asphalt (blown asphalt: straight asphalt = 1: 1, manufactured by Showa Shell Sekiyu KK) is kneaded with a mixture consisting of 30% by weight, 44% by weight of calcium carbonate and 26% by weight of wood polishing powder, and rolled to 2 mm. 3 kg of damping material was used.
[0016]
[Test method 1]
The punching properties (trim property at the time of heating and pressing) and the dropping property (adhesion to the uneven steel sheet surface) of the vibration damping materials of Examples and Comparative Examples were tested.
[0017]
[Test method 2]
The loss coefficient η at each temperature of 20 ° C., 40 ° C., and 60 ° C. was measured by a resonance method (refer to page 438 of “Noise Countermeasure Handbook” published by The Japan Society of Acoustic Materials). It is considered that the larger the value of η, the higher the damping effect.
[0018]

【The invention's effect】
It has been clarified that the vibration damping material using wood flour according to the present invention improves the flexibility of the sheet and the vibration damping performance particularly at a temperature of 40 ° C. or higher.
